Freigeben über


WorkItemStore-Klasse

Stellt die Arbeitsaufgabenverfolgungsclient-Verbindung zu einem Server dar, der Team Foundation Server ausführt.

Vererbungshierarchie

System.Object
  Microsoft.TeamFoundation.WorkItemTracking.Client.WorkItemStore

Namespace:  Microsoft.TeamFoundation.WorkItemTracking.Client
Assembly:  Microsoft.TeamFoundation.WorkItemTracking.Client (in Microsoft.TeamFoundation.WorkItemTracking.Client.dll)

Syntax

'Declaration
Public NotInheritable Class WorkItemStore _
    Implements ITfsTeamProjectCollectionObject
public sealed class WorkItemStore : ITfsTeamProjectCollectionObject

Der WorkItemStore-Typ macht die folgenden Member verfügbar.

Konstruktoren

  Name Beschreibung
Öffentliche Methode WorkItemStore(String) Initialisiert eine neue Instanz der WorkItemStore-Klasse, die mit dem Server verbunden ist, der Team Foundation Server ausführt, das durch den Computernamen angegeben wird.
Öffentliche Methode WorkItemStore(TeamFoundationServer) Veraltet. Initialisiert eine neue Instanz der WorkItemStore-Klasse, die an die angegebene TeamFoundationServer-Instanz verbunden ist.
Öffentliche Methode WorkItemStore(TfsTeamProjectCollection) Initialisiert eine neue Instanz der WorkItemStore-Klasse, die an die angegebene TfsTeamProjectCollection-Instanz verbunden ist.
Öffentliche Methode WorkItemStore(String, WorkItemStoreFlags)
Öffentliche Methode WorkItemStore(TfsTeamProjectCollection, WorkItemStoreFlags)

Zum Seitenanfang

Eigenschaften

  Name Beschreibung
Öffentliche Eigenschaft BypassRules Ruft ab, bzw. legt fest, ob die Arbeitsaufgabenspeicher-Objektüberbrückung anordnet
Öffentliche Eigenschaft CallingProcessIdentity Veraltet. Ruft ab oder legt diese Zeichenfolge fest, die den aufrufenden Prozess zum Server identifiziert.
Öffentliche Eigenschaft ClientService
Öffentliche Eigenschaft CultureInfo Ruft die Lokalisierungsumgebung ab, die vom Client verwendet wird.
Öffentliche Eigenschaft Diagnostics Ruft das Diagnosenobjekt ab, das dieser Serververbindung zugeordnet ist.
Öffentliche Eigenschaft FieldDefinitions Ruft die Auflistung von Felddefinitionen ab, die dieser WorkItemStore-Instanz zugeordnet werden.
Öffentliche Eigenschaft MaxBulkUpdateBatchSize
Öffentliche Eigenschaft Metadata
Öffentliche Eigenschaft Projects Ruft die Auflistung von Project s ab, die dieser WorkItemStore-Instanz zugeordnet ist.
Öffentliche Eigenschaft QueryHierarchyProvider
Öffentliche Eigenschaft RegisteredLinkTypes Ruft RegisteredLinkTypeCollection zwischengespeicherte ab, das diesem Server zugeordnet ist.
Öffentliche Eigenschaft ServerInfo Ruft das Serverinformationsobjekt ab, das alle Funktionen enthält, die vom Server unterstützt werden.
Öffentliche Eigenschaft ServerStringComparer
Öffentliche Eigenschaft TeamFoundationServer Veraltet. Ruft die Verbindung zum Server ab, der Team Foundation Server ausführt.
Öffentliche Eigenschaft TeamProjectCollection Ruft die Verbindung zum Server ab, der Team Foundation Server ausführt.
Öffentliche Eigenschaft TimeZone Ruft die Zeitzone des Clients ab.
Öffentliche Eigenschaft UserDisplayMode Ruft den Modus ab, in dem Benutzerkontoinformationen für diesen Arbeitsaufgabenspeicher angezeigt werden.
Öffentliche Eigenschaft UserDisplayName
Öffentliche Eigenschaft UserSid
Öffentliche Eigenschaft WebServiceUrl
Öffentliche Eigenschaft WorkItemLinkTypes Ruft WorkItemLinkTypeCollection zwischengespeicherte ab, das dem Server zugeordnet ist.

Zum Seitenanfang

Methoden

  Name Beschreibung
Öffentliche Methode BatchSave(array<WorkItem[]) Führt mehrere Elemente in einer Verzweigung einen Commit und gibt eine Liste von Fehlern zurück, wenn eine oder mehrere Elemente fehlschlagen.
Öffentliche Methode BatchSave(array<WorkItem[], SaveFlags) Führt mehrere Elemente in einer Verzweigung einen Commit und gibt eine Liste von Fehlern zurück, wenn eine oder mehrere Elemente fehlschlagen.
Öffentliche Methode CacheConstantStrings
Öffentliche Methode DestroyWorkItems Zerstört Arbeitsaufgaben, die die angegebene ID haben.
Öffentliche Methode Equals Bestimmt, ob das angegebene Objekt mit dem aktuellen Objekt identisch ist. (Von Object geerbt.)
Öffentliche Methode ExportGlobalLists Exportiert alle Daten, die in den globalen Listen der Datenbank zu XmlDocument gespeichert wird.
Öffentliche Methode GetGlobalAndProjectGroups
Öffentliche Methode GetHashCode Fungiert als Hashfunktion für einen bestimmten Typ. (Von Object geerbt.)
Öffentliche Methode GetNodePermissions
Öffentliche Methode GetPersonNameById
Öffentliche Methode GetQueryDefinition Ruft eine Abfragedefinition ab, die durch das angegebene GUID identifiziert wird.
Öffentliche Methode GetQueryHierarchy
Öffentliche Methode GetReferencingWorkItemUris Ruft ein Array Arbeitsaufgabenuniform resource identifier (URI) dieser Punkt zur angegebenen Arbeitsaufgabe ab.
Öffentliche Methode GetStoredQuery Veraltet. Ruft eine gespeicherte Abfrage durch GUID ab.
Öffentliche Methode GetType Ruft den Type der aktuellen Instanz ab. (Von Object geerbt.)
Öffentliche Methode GetWorkItem(Int32) Ruft die Arbeitsaufgabe ab, die die angegebene ID besitzt
Öffentliche Methode GetWorkItem(Uri) Ruft die Arbeitsaufgabe am angegebenen URIs ab.
Öffentliche Methode GetWorkItem(Int32, DateTime) Ruft den vorherigen Zustand einer Arbeitsaufgabe, die bis zu ID und Datum angegeben wird.
Öffentliche Methode GetWorkItem(Int32, Int32) Ruft den vorherigen Zustand einer Arbeitsaufgabe ab, die von ID und Revisionsnummer angegeben wird.
Öffentliche Methode GetWorkItem(Uri, DateTime) Ruft den Arbeitsaufgabenzustand von einem bestimmten Zeitpunkt zum Anzeigen ab.
Öffentliche Methode GetWorkItem(Uri, Int32) Ruft den Arbeitsaufgabenzustand von einer bestimmten Revision zum Anzeigen ab.
Öffentliche Methode GetWorkItemIdsForArtifactUris Eine Liste der Artefaktlinks, die mit ihren verweisenden Arbeitsaufgaben zugeordnet werden.
Öffentliche Methode ImportGlobalLists(String) Importe haben globale Listen (im XML-Format) in der Datenbank.
Öffentliche Methode ImportGlobalLists(XmlElement) Importiert globale Listen in die Datenbank.
Öffentliche Methode InvalidateCacheStamp
Öffentliche Methode Query(String) Führt die Abfrage, die in wiql beschrieben wird aus und gibt eine Auflistung von Arbeitsaufgaben zurück.
Öffentliche Methode Query(array<Int32[], String) Ruft den Satz von Feldern ab, der in wiql für die Arbeitsaufgaben verweist, die als eine ID-Nummer ().ids angegeben werden.
Öffentliche Methode Query(String, IDictionary) Führt die Abfrage aus, die in wiql und in den Parametern beschrieben wird, die in context beschrieben werden.
Öffentliche Methode Query(BatchReadParameterCollection, String) Ruft den Satz von Feldern ab, der in Wiql für die Arbeitsaufgaben bezeichnet wird, die von der IDs-/revisionpaare in batchReadParams angegeben werden.
Öffentliche Methode Query(array<Int32[], array<Int32[], String) Ruft den Satz von Feldern ab, der in wiql für die Arbeitsaufgaben verweist, die als eine ID-Nummer, ids und Revision (revs) angegeben werden.
Öffentliche Methode Query(array<Int32[], String, DateTime) Ruft den Satz von Feldern ab, der in wiql für die Arbeitsaufgaben verweist, die als eine ID-Nummer (ids) ab dem Datum angegeben werden, das in asof angegeben wird.
Öffentliche Methode QueryCount(String) Ruft die Anzahl von Elementen ab, die zurückgegeben werden, wenn die Abfrage ausgeführt wurde.
Öffentliche Methode QueryCount(String, IDictionary) Ruft die Anzahl von Elementen ab, die zurückgegeben werden, wenn die Abfrage ausgeführt wurde.
Öffentliche Methode RefreshCache() Ruft das Ende an, um zwischengespeicherte Metadaten zu aktualisieren.
Öffentliche Methode RefreshCache(Boolean)
Öffentliche Methode ResetCachedData
Öffentliche Methode ResetConstantStringCache
Öffentliche Methode SendUpdatePackage
Öffentliche Methode SyncToCache Synchronisierung zur neuesten Version des Caches.
Öffentliche Methode ToString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t. (Von Object geerbt.)
Öffentliche Methode TreeIdToPath

Zum Seitenanfang

Ereignisse

  Name Beschreibung
Öffentliches Ereignis ImportEventHandler Ein Ereignis, das während ImportGlobalLists-Aufrufs auftritt.
Öffentliches Ereignis MetadataChanged Ein Ereignis, das auftritt, wenn Metadaten geändert wird, nachdem die Änderung durch das Objektmodell verarbeitet wird.
Öffentliches Ereignis MetadataChanging Veraltet. Ein Ereignis, das auftritt, wenn Metadaten geändert wird, bevor die Änderung durch das Objektmodell verarbeitet wird.

Zum Seitenanfang

Explizite Schnittstellenimplementierungen

  Name Beschreibung
Explizite SchnittstellenimplementierungPrivate Methode ITfsTeamProjectCollectionObject.Initialize

Zum Seitenanfang

Hinweise

Weitere Informationen zur Verwendung dieses Typs finden Sie unter Erstellen einer Arbeitsaufgabe mithilfe des Clientobjektmodells für Team Foundation.

Threadsicherheit

Alle öffentlichen static (Shared in Visual Basic)-Member dieses Typs sind threadsicher. Bei Instanzmembern ist die Threadsicherheit nicht gewährleistet.

Siehe auch

Referenz

Microsoft.TeamFoundation.WorkItemTracking.Client-Namespace